Android 6: broken commands, crashes, caching issues(?)
See original GitHub issueThe following issues seem significantly different in nature, but also exclusive to my Android 6 Marshmello tablet, and can’t be reproduced on Android 7 or 11, so I’m bundling them here.
Specific actions that stand out:
- Every command produces the Error message
Command error Unrecognized command: /
Screenshot of command error
- Using
[enter]
on a physical keyboard (to send a message)instantly crashes the application, bringing you back to the application homescreen with the error report prompt, and even though the app updates, it can't be interacted with (like most of te OS) because of a System message "Unfortunately, Element has stopped", which will kill the app once interacted withIncidentally, you can use a command just fine by pressingScreenshots
[enter]
on a physical keyboard, which also alleviates the crash until app restart. - At some point pictures and videos in messages will stop rendering, clicking them will just display nothingness. At a later point they will stop taking additional space on the screen. They're still clickable, but the app redirects you do a gallery app, where the images are still viewable. Clearing the cache from system settings resolves the problem for a while.
- The application can start being really slow, shortly followed by a crash seemingly out of nowhere.
- Generally the application is very sluggish compared to almost any other app, though I can't tell if this is simply the technology Element is based on.
- Sometimes the rooms sidebar registers the clicks but does not redirect to any room, behavior resets when a room is opened manually
- Clicking a notification only opens the homescreen. Earlier I would also get something along the lines of
Error: malformed link
- Notifications are not automatically cleared unless all of the according rooms were visited
The tablet is rooted (but not really modified) and I can use adb if that helps to identify the issues.
